    Radiohead just has a greater body of work.

    OK Computer and In Rainbows were released 10 years apart and masterpieces. That's like Terminator and T2: Judgement Day to put it in Tinman terms.

    Those albums bookend Kid A which was perhaps their most critically celebrated albums (although I like Amnesiac better).

    Oasis could argue they had a greater peak as far as pop culture, but had no staying power and crumbled under their own ego.
